This is fire country, and homeowners here know it. Large lots backing to groves, brush, and hillsides mean ember exposure during Santa Ana events is a genuine planning factor, not an afterthought. That drives real material choices, with many owners favoring Class A tile or metal, defensible-space-friendly edge details, and clean, non-combustible transitions.
The rural setting also brings practical roofing realities. Groves and mature trees drop debris that collects in valleys and gutters, wind sweeps unobstructed across open land and stresses roof edges, and custom architecture often means complex rooflines with more valleys, dormers, and transitions than a standard home, each of which is a place water and embers can find a way in.

What roof is best for a fire-exposed Twin Oaks Valley property?
Both concrete or clay tile and metal are Class A materials well suited to the valley's wildfire exposure, and the right choice depends on your home's architecture and budget. What matters just as much as the covering is the detailing: clean valleys, ember-resistant edges, and non-combustible transitions.
